Windshield was damaged beyond repair at only 250 miles. Replacement windshield took 6 weeks. Glass seems to be thin or more prone to damage. Vehicle was traveling at approximately 45 mph on a two-lane road and was hit by some sort of debris from a vehicle going in the opposite direction. Did not see the debris before it struck the window.

I had a small rock hit my windshield from road grading. It was a normal chip, not unlike any that I have had on other vehicles. I called to make an appointment the next day to have it filled to prevent spreading. Leaving work the next day, the windshield had actually cracked from top to bottom and to the left, in an L shape. So, my chip repair became a full windshield replacement. I have now been waiting 3+ weeks for a replacement as they are not available. My auto glass place has had one on order from overseas since that next day. So, 4-6 weeks to replace a windshield that truly should not have broken as the chip was no different than any other chip we get in vehicles. I actually tried to have the replacement done by my Kia dealership. The service department said there were none available in the us and good luck finding one, they were unable to help. When I called today to inquire about having the cameras re calibrated post the replacement, I was told that if a non-Kia approved windshield is put in, I would void my warranty. So, beyond waiting weeks on end to have a broken windshield replaced, being told 'good luck' finding one and too bad, they can't help me, I am now being told I "may" have my warranty voided having it replaced elsewhere, even though they refused to assist.

Three days after we purchased a 2020 Telluride I found a cracked in the bottom center of the windshield. I couldn't find any chip that might have started the crack, it just appeared the next morning. The car was parked under the carport so nothing could have fallen on the windshield. Contacted the dealer and they were no help at all, insurance had to pay. Safelite auto glass had to wait eight weeks for Kia to ship a new windshield. I asked the installer to look at the crack area and see if he could find a cause that would start this crack. He explained to me that any rock or foreign object strike will leave an indentation with some spider marks, he found none" his prognosis was, it was struck on the bottom edge when assembled and closing the door hard would flex the windshield and that started the crack. It has been one month and I already have another small chip. I have replaced one windshield in forty something years, doesn't very look good for Telluride owners, something is wrong"

While driving my 2020 Telluride I heard an odd sound on the passenger side of the vehicle and noticed a small crack developing on the passenger side of windshield. It started from about midway heading horizontally and then made a curve upward as I drove. The crack is at least 18 inches long. There is no visible damage or markings of anything hitting the windshield nor did I notice anything strike the windshield. The crack originates underneath the molding and appears to be a defect. When the crack started I was traveling on a city street at around 30 miles an hour with no traffic around.
